Trump's "Mega-Law" Playbook: A Reality Check on Election Lawsuits and Legal Challenges

The 2020 and 2024 elections saw a flurry of lawsuits and legal challenges, many originating from Donald Trump's camp, leading to discussions around a so-called "mega-law" strategy. This article provides a reality check on the effectiveness and implications of this approach, examining its successes, failures, and the broader impact on election law and public trust. We'll analyze key aspects, including the legal strategies employed, the courts' responses, and the long-term consequences for American democracy.

H2: Understanding Trump's Legal Strategy: A "Mega-Law" Approach

Donald Trump's post-election legal strategy, often described as a "mega-law" approach, involved filing numerous lawsuits across multiple jurisdictions, targeting various aspects of the electoral process. These lawsuits frequently alleged widespread voter fraud, irregularities, and illegal voting practices. The aim was not simply to overturn election results in specific states but to create a cascading effect, ultimately challenging the legitimacy of the entire election. This strategy heavily relied on:

  • Multiple Lawsuits in Different States: This tactic aimed to overwhelm the legal system and increase the chances of success in at least one jurisdiction.
  • Targeting Specific Voting Processes: Challenges focused on mail-in ballots, absentee voting, vote counting procedures, and election equipment.
  • Emphasis on Claims of Voter Fraud: Despite a lack of widespread evidence supporting these claims, the lawsuits consistently emphasized the prevalence of voter fraud to garner public support and create doubt about election integrity.
  • Utilizing a Network of Lawyers: Trump employed a team of lawyers, some with varying degrees of experience in election law, to simultaneously pursue these multiple cases.

H3: Key Cases and Their Outcomes

Many of the lawsuits filed by the Trump campaign and its allies were dismissed by judges at both the state and federal levels. Key examples include:

  • Pennsylvania Election Lawsuits: Numerous cases challenging Pennsylvania's election procedures were ultimately rejected due to lack of evidence and procedural irregularities.
  • Georgia Election Lawsuits: Similar outcomes were observed in Georgia, where challenges failed to demonstrate significant evidence of fraud influencing the election results.
  • Wisconsin Election Lawsuits: Attempts to challenge Wisconsin's election results were also largely unsuccessful, as courts found the allegations lacked sufficient merit.

These failures highlight the difficulties in proving widespread voter fraud in a transparent legal system and the crucial role of evidence-based arguments in election challenges.

H2: The Impact on Election Integrity and Public Trust

Trump's legal strategy, regardless of its legal outcomes, had a profound impact on public perception and trust in the electoral process. The constant stream of unsubstantiated allegations of fraud, amplified by partisan media outlets, contributed to political polarization and distrust in democratic institutions. This erosion of trust poses a significant challenge to the future of American democracy.

  • Spread of Misinformation: The sheer volume of lawsuits, even if unsuccessful, created an environment ripe for the spread of misinformation and conspiracy theories about election fraud.
  • Increased Political Polarization: The legal battles further exacerbated existing political divisions, creating a deeper rift between supporters and opponents of Donald Trump.
  • Undermining Democratic Institutions: Repeated challenges to the integrity of the electoral process, without credible evidence, can undermine public confidence in the fairness and legitimacy of elections.

H3: The Role of the Judiciary

The judiciary played a vital role in assessing the merits of the various lawsuits. While some judges expressed concerns about certain aspects of election procedures, the overwhelming majority dismissed the cases due to a lack of evidence to support claims of widespread fraud. This underscores the importance of an independent judiciary in upholding the rule of law and protecting the integrity of the election process.

H2: Long-Term Consequences and Future Implications

The aftermath of the 2020 and 2024 election challenges has significant long-term implications for election law and the political landscape.

  • Increased Scrutiny of Election Procedures: The lawsuits have prompted a renewed focus on improving election security and transparency. Discussions around election reform and modernization are ongoing in many states.
  • Potential for Future Legal Challenges: The strategy employed by Trump's legal team may inspire future attempts to challenge election results through similar legal tactics.
  • Strengthening of Election Laws: In response to the challenges, some states are enacting stricter election laws, while others are exploring ways to make the voting process more accessible and efficient.

H2: Conclusion:

Donald Trump's "mega-law" approach to challenging election results proved largely unsuccessful. While the strategy generated significant media attention and fueled partisan divisions, the overwhelming majority of the lawsuits were dismissed due to a lack of evidence. The long-term consequences of these legal battles include a heightened focus on election security, increased political polarization, and ongoing debates about election reform. The outcome underscores the critical role of evidence-based legal arguments and the importance of maintaining public trust in the fairness and integrity of the American electoral system. The experience serves as a cautionary tale regarding the misuse of legal processes for partisan political gain and the potential dangers of undermining democratic institutions through unsubstantiated claims of widespread fraud.
